Advantage One FCU Opts for State Charter

Advantage One Federal Credit Union, based in Brownstown, Mich., received permission from the NCUA and the State of Michigan to convert from a federal charter to a state charter. The transition, which includes a name change to Advantage Credit Union, gives the $133 million institution the ability to serve additional communities.

"Advantage One is a very strong and well-capitalized credit union," CEO Chris Corkery said, "Because of our strength and strong loan growth over the years, we feel this is the best time to position ourselves for the future growth and provide the ability to serve more families, friends and neighbors in our communities," he added.

Currently, Advantage serves 15,000 members but hopes to increase that number through extending its reach to the Clinton, Eaton, Genesee, Hillsdale, Ingham, Jackson, Lapeer, Lenewee, Livingston, Macomb, Monroe, Oakland, Shiawassee, St. Clair, Washtenaw and Wayne communities.
